Founded in 1847 by Mormon leader Brigham Young, Salt Lake City has evolved into Utah's vibrant capital and the economic, cultural, and political heart of the state. As the host of the 2002 Winter Olympics and home to a booming tech industry, thriving arts scene, and unparalleled outdoor recreation access, Salt Lake City offers homebuyers a unique blend of urban amenities and mountain lifestyle. With the Wasatch Mountains as its backdrop and world-class skiing just 30 minutes away, Salt Lake City presents exceptional real estate opportunities for those seeking adventure, career growth, and quality of life.

Why Choose Salt Lake City Utah Real Estate?

Salt Lake City consistently ranks among the nation's top cities for job growth, quality of life, and outdoor recreation. The city's economy is robust and diverse, with thriving industries in technology (part of the Silicon Slopes corridor), healthcare, finance, and tourism. Major employers include Intermountain Healthcare, the University of Utah, Delta Airlines, and numerous tech companies that have relocated to benefit from Utah's business-friendly environment and educated workforce.

Beyond career opportunities, Salt Lake City offers an exceptional lifestyle. Within 30 minutes of downtown, residents can access seven world-class ski resorts including Alta, Snowbird, Brighton, and Solitude. The city itself features a walkable downtown with light rail transit, diverse dining and entertainment options, professional sports teams, and a thriving arts community. The combination of urban sophistication and outdoor adventure makes Salt Lake City one of America's most desirable places to call home.

Outdoor Recreation

Utah is renowned for its exceptional outdoor recreation opportunities. With its diverse landscapes and proximity to nature, Salt Lake City is a paradise for outdoor enthusiasts.

World-Class Skiing

The Wasatch Mountains provide some of the best skiing in the world. Known for having the "greatest snow on Earth," Utah attracts skiers and snowboarders from all over. Seven ski resorts are within 45 minutes of downtown, making Salt Lake City one of the few major cities with such convenient access to world-class skiing.

Mountain Biking and Hiking

Aside from skiing, Salt Lake City offers world-class mountain biking, hiking, and trail running. Popular trails include Millcreek Canyon, Big Cottonwood Canyon, and City Creek Canyon. The variety of activities ensures there's something for everyone year-round.

National Parks Access

Utah is home to five stunning national parks, all accessible within a few hours' drive from Salt Lake City. These parks, along with numerous lakes and reservoirs, offer endless exploration opportunities for weekend getaways.

Frequently Asked Questions About Living in Salt Lake City

What is the cost of living in Salt Lake City?

Salt Lake City's cost of living is moderate compared to other major Western cities. While housing costs have risen due to strong demand, they remain significantly more affordable than comparable cities like Denver, Seattle, or San Francisco. The median home price is around $898,507, with diverse options across price points. Other living expenses including groceries, utilities, and transportation are close to or slightly below national averages.

How is the job market in Salt Lake City?

Salt Lake City boasts one of the strongest job markets in the nation, consistently ranking number one for job opportunities and job growth. The economy is diverse with thriving industries in technology (Silicon Slopes), healthcare, finance, tourism, and education. Major employers include Intermountain Healthcare, University of Utah, Delta Airlines, Adobe, and numerous tech startups. The unemployment rate consistently remains below national averages, and the city continues to attract businesses relocating from higher-cost markets.

What are the best neighborhoods in Salt Lake City?

Popular neighborhoods include the Avenues (historic homes with tree-lined streets and mountain views), Sugar House (walkable urban village with shops and restaurants), Federal Heights (luxury homes with spectacular views), Capitol Hill (close to downtown with historic architecture), the 9th & 9th district (trendy area with local boutiques and cafes), and Cottonwood Heights on the east side with excellent schools and canyon access. Each neighborhood offers unique character and amenities.

How are the schools in Salt Lake City?

Salt Lake City School District is the oldest in Utah, serving approximately 25,000 students across 27 elementary schools, five middle schools, and three high schools. The district also offers numerous highly-rated charter schools focused on engineering, math, and specialized curricula. The University of Utah, one of the nation's top research universities, enriches the educational landscape. For families prioritizing education, neighborhoods in the east benches and Cottonwood Heights area offer access to top-performing schools.

What about air quality in Salt Lake City?

Air quality is an important consideration for Salt Lake City residents. During winter months, temperature inversions can trap cold air and pollutants in the valley, leading to temporary periods of poor air quality. However, air quality is excellent most of the year, and the state has implemented various measures to improve conditions. Many residents live on the east benches or in the canyons where air quality is consistently better due to higher elevation and air circulation.

Is Salt Lake City a safe place to live?

Salt Lake City is generally a safe city with crime rates below many comparable metropolitan areas. Violent crime rates are historically low, contributing to a sense of security for residents. Like any urban area, petty crimes such as theft are more common in certain downtown areas, but overall Utah remains one of the safer states in the nation. Neighborhoods on the east side, the Avenues, and suburban areas have particularly low crime rates and strong community watch programs.

Four Seasons of Salt Lake City

Salt Lake City features four distinct seasons, each offering unique experiences. Cold, snowy winters provide world-class skiing and winter sports from November through April. Springs are mild and beautiful as the mountains bloom. Summers are hot and dry, perfect for hiking, mountain biking, and lake activities. Fall brings spectacular foliage in the canyons with comfortable temperatures ideal for outdoor recreation.

Cultural Scene and Entertainment

Salt Lake City boasts a thriving cultural scene with numerous opportunities to engage in arts, entertainment, and events. The city is home to world-class institutions including the Utah Symphony, Ballet West, Utah Opera, and the Tony Award-winning Pioneer Theatre Company. The Sundance Film Festival, held annually in nearby Park City, brings international film culture to the region.

Downtown Salt Lake features numerous museums including the Natural History Museum of Utah, Utah Museum of Fine Arts, and the Leonardo science and art museum. The city hosts professional sports teams (NBA's Utah Jazz, MLS's Real Salt Lake) and numerous festivals celebrating music, food, and culture throughout the year.
